Home
last modified time | relevance | path

Searched refs:offlineDatabase (Results 1 – 3 of 3) sorted by relevance

/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/platform/default/
H A Ddefault_file_source.cpp25 , offlineDatabase(std::make_unique<OfflineDatabase>(cachePath, maximumCacheSize)) { in Impl()
50 callback({}, offlineDatabase->listRegions()); in listRegions()
60 callback({}, offlineDatabase->createRegion(definition, metadata)); in createRegion()
70 callback({}, offlineDatabase->updateMetadata(regionID, metadata)); in updateMetadata()
87 offlineDatabase->deleteRegion(std::move(region)); in deleteRegion()
116 auto offlineResponse = offlineDatabase->get(resource); in request()
152 this->offlineDatabase->put(resource, onlineResponse); in request()
172 offlineDatabase->setOfflineMapboxTileCountLimit(limit); in setOfflineMapboxTileCountLimit()
180 offlineDatabase->put(resource, response); in put()
190 …std::make_unique<OfflineDownload>(regionID, offlineDatabase->getRegionDefinition(regionID), *offli… in getDownload()
[all …]
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/mapbox-gl-native/platform/default/mbgl/storage/
H A Doffline_download.cpp33 offlineDatabase(offlineDatabase_), in OfflineDownload()
65 OfflineRegionStatus result = offlineDatabase.getRegionCompletedStatus(id); in getStatus()
68 optional<Response> styleResponse = offlineDatabase.get(Resource::style(definition.styleURL)); in getStatus()
88 optional<Response> sourceResponse = offlineDatabase.get(Resource::source(url)); in getStatus()
309 return offlineDatabase.hasRegionResource(id, resource); in ensureResource()
311 …optional<std::pair<Response, uint64_t>> response = offlineDatabase.getRegionResource(id, resource); in ensureResource()
333 if (offlineDatabase.exceedsOfflineMapboxTileCountLimit(resource)) { in ensureResource()
357 offlineDatabase.putRegionResources(id, buffer, status); in ensureResource()
367 if (offlineDatabase.exceedsOfflineMapboxTileCountLimit(resource)) { in ensureResource()
378 observer->mapboxTileCountLimitExceeded(offlineDatabase.getOfflineMapboxTileCountLimit()); in onMapboxTileCountLimitExceeded()
H A Doffline_download.hpp54 OfflineDatabase& offlineDatabase; member in mbgl::OfflineDownload